在现代的编程领域中,PHP 和 git 都是非常重要的技能。面试官们往往会在面试中考察这两方面的知识,尤其是编程算法的应用。本文将介绍 php 和 Git 在面试中的编程算法考察,并且会提供一些相关的演示代码。 PHP 在面试中的编程算法考
在现代的编程领域中,PHP 和 git 都是非常重要的技能。面试官们往往会在面试中考察这两方面的知识,尤其是编程算法的应用。本文将介绍 php 和 Git 在面试中的编程算法考察,并且会提供一些相关的演示代码。
PHP 在面试中的编程算法考察
在 PHP 的面试中,编程算法考察是很常见的。PHP 是一种脚本语言,因此在编写算法时,需要考虑到效率和速度等因素。以下是一些常见的 PHP 算法问题:
在 PHP 中,数组排序是一个非常重要的算法问题。以下是一个例子,演示如何使用 PHP 中的 sort() 函数对数组进行排序。
$numbers = array(4, 2, 1, 3, 5);
sort($numbers);
print_r($numbers);
在 PHP 中,查找数组中的最大值和最小值也是一个常见的算法问题。以下是一个例子,演示如何使用 PHP 中的 max() 和 min() 函数查找数组中的最大值和最小值。
$numbers = array(4, 2, 1, 3, 5);
echo "最大值: " . max($numbers) . "<br>";
echo "最小值: " . min($numbers);
在 PHP 中,查找字符串中的重复字符也是一个常见的算法问题。以下是一个例子,演示如何使用 PHP 中的 count_chars() 函数查找字符串中的重复字符。
$string = "hello world";
$chars = count_chars($string, 1);
foreach ($chars as $char => $count) {
if ($count > 1) {
echo "字符 "" . chr($char) . "" 重复了 " . $count . " 次。";
}
}
Git 在面试中的编程算法考察
在 Git 的面试中,编程算法考察也是很常见的。Git 是一种版本控制系统,因此在编写算法时,需要考虑到版本控制和分支管理等因素。以下是一些常见的 Git 算法问题:
在 Git 中,合并分支是一个非常重要的算法问题。以下是一个例子,演示如何使用 Git 中的 merge 命令合并分支。
$ git checkout master
$ git merge feature
在 Git 中,回滚代码也是一个常见的算法问题。以下是一个例子,演示如何使用 Git 中的 revert 命令回滚代码。
$ git revert HEAD
在 Git 中,查看提交历史也是一个常见的算法问题。以下是一个例子,演示如何使用 Git 中的 log 命令查看提交历史。
$ git log
结论
在面试中,PHP 和 Git 都是非常重要的技能。编程算法考察是其中一个重要的方面。本文介绍了一些常见的 PHP 和 Git 算法问题,并提供了一些相关的演示代码。希望本文能够对读者在面试中表现更出色有所帮助。
--结束END--
本文标题: PHP 和 Git 在面试中的编程算法考察?
本文链接: https://www.lsjlt.com/news/377716.html(转载时请注明来源链接)
有问题或投稿请发送至: 邮箱/279061341@qq.com QQ/279061341
2024-02-29
2024-02-29
2024-02-29
2024-02-29
2024-02-29
2024-02-29
2024-02-29
2024-02-29
2024-02-29
2024-02-29
回答
回答
回答
回答
回答
回答
回答
回答
回答
回答
0